Profile
Andrew Parsons received his law degree from the University of Saskatchewan, and was called to the bar in Newfoundland and Labrador in 2005. First elected in 2011, Andrew previously served as Opposition House Leader and critic for multiple departments. Prior to his current role, he has also served as Minister of Justice and Public Safety, Attorney General, Minister of Municipal Affairs & Environment, and Government House Leader.
Andrew is a past president of the Port aux Basques Minor Hockey, and has served on various committees, including the Port aux Basques Chamber of Commerce and Dr. Charles L. LeGrow Health Care Foundation. Andrew and his family reside in his hometown of Channel-Port aux Basques.

Responsibility | Start Date | End Date |
---|---|---|
Minister of Industry, Energy and Technology | April 2021 | Current |
Minister of Industry, Energy and Technology, and Attorney General | August 2020 | April 2021 |
Minister of Justice and Public Safety, Attorney General, and Minister Responsible for the Access to Information and Protection of Privacy Office | November 2018 | August 2020 |
Minister of Justice and Public Safety and Attorney General, Minister of Municipal Affairs and Environment (Acting), Minister Responsible for the MMSB and the Office of Climate Change | April 2018 | November 2018 |
Minister of Justice and Public Safety, and Attorney General | December 2015 | April 2018 |
Government House Leader | December 2015 | October 2019 |
Opposition House Leader | April 2013 | December 2015 |
Management Commission Member | April 2013 | October 2019 |
Deputy Opposition House Leader | November 2011 | April 2013 |
